General
Characteristics
Constant Current Drive - 4
Channels
Common Voltage Source on
all 4 channels
Voltage setting is common to all
channels while each channel can
control current independently
Continuous Mode with Bucking Regulator
Max Output Current: 8A 2A max per channel x 4 channels
Max Output Voltage = Input
Voltage - 2.5V (Nominal)
Constant Current Output in
Continuous Mode
Min Output Voltage: 5V 0.01 A resolution
Max Output Power Limited
Continuous Mode without Bucking Regulator
Max Output Current: 8A
Constant Current Output in
Continuous Mode
2A max per channel X 4 Channels
Output Voltage = Input Voltage
- 1.5V (Nominal)
Pulsed Mode
Pulse Mode, Maximum Average
Power: 34W
4V droop per channel during high
current pulses
Max Output Current: 25 A /
Channel
100 A Max output when 4 channels
are used
Max Output Voltage: 100 VDC
1.0 A Resolution on 25 A Scale, 0.1
A on 10 A Scale and 0.01 A on 1
A Scale
Max Output Voltage = Input
Voltage - 1V
Minimum output voltage in pulse
mode is Vinput - 1V
Pulse Width Range: 1 - 999µS
Max Frequency: 200Hz Power Limited
Trigger to Pulse Latency: <2 µS
Trigger Delay: 0 - 999 µS
1 µS resolution
Pulse Width Variation (pulse to
pulse): < 1µS
Pulse Amplitude Variation (pulse
to pulse): < 1%
